Abstract

Partnerships between public schools and institutions of higher education provide teachers with opportunities for leadership. Teachers at the University of Wyoming (UW) Lab School belong to a community of learners and leaders partnering with the UW’s Education College. In this school–university partnership, a strong culture endures in which teachers are viewed as leaders supporting the preparation of future educators and embracing active involvement in the school community. Professional development practices are implemented through the partnership to enhance teacher leadership skills. This chapter explores how professional learning communities, school learning walks, and co-teaching strategies support lab school teacher leaders as learners and change agents.
